    Thanks for the add, I am the proud owner of an 11 plate 2.0 CDTi SRi 160, having just come from an 05 plate Vectra C 1.9CDTi Club.
    So far I am loving the Insignia but I do have a couple of questions for the more experienced members. (the car is still under dealer used car warranty so I want to get any issues resolved while it is!)
    1. There is a vibration through floor when cornering and when turning under full left or right lock. (The dealer is telling me that this was caused by misaligned engine mounts; (sounds like b@ll@cks to me!), they have "fixed it" but there is still a vibration).
    2. The rear windscreen demist takes a really long time to work: screen heavily misted 19/2/19, screen took 45 minutes to clear. (is this normal; the Vectra started to clear instantly and was usually fully clear in about 5-10 minutes?)
